About this school

Cutler Elementary School is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in W. Swanzey, Cheshire County. The school has 289 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Monadnock Regional School District school district. It serves grades 3โ€“6 in a rural setting. The school employs 20.8 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 13.9:1. 30% of students are proficient in reading. 26% are proficient in maths. Technology infrastructure includes fiber internet, campus-wide Wi-Fi, devices for students.

Free & reduced-price lunch

93 of the school's 289 students (32%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 78 qualify for free lunch and 15 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.

School district: Monadnock Regional School District

Cutler Elementary School is one of 7 schools in Monadnock Regional School District, based in Swanzey, New Hampshire. The district serves 1,610 students district-wide and employs 125 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 289 students, Cutler Elementary School is larger than the district average of about 230 students per school.
